Abstract

See full text

A 3,4-dihydrobenzoxazine compound of the present invention is represented by the following formula [1] (wherein X is a nitrogen atom or CR.sup.3; R.sup.1 is a hydrogen atom or a halogen atom; R.sup.2 is a C1-6 alkoxy group which may be substituted with the same or different 1 to 5 substituents selected from a halogen atom and a hydroxyl group; and R.sup.3 is a halogen atom. However, R.sup.1 is a halogen atom when X is CR.sup.3). This compound is effective in treating diseases to which the vanilloid receptor subtype 1 (VR1) activity is involved, such as pain, etc. ##STR00001##
